You can also do cake shooters or cake shots. Alternate cake and icing/filling in a shot glass.
I've made cakes in oven proof coffee cups, but u have to make sure they say oven safe! I bought a white set (with a 20 percent coupon) at bed bath beyond - a full size cup set and espresso set. Not a mug but a nice shaped cup. It's more batter for the full size cup than a cupcake so you have to watch the oven for doneness. And I use vegetable spray inside the cup. No problem. Ive used chocolate cake, tried it frosted and unfrosted with a white frosting ring around the top. I haven't posted any pix but Ive also used a piece of a chocolate covered preztel for a handle! I'm still fine tuning this idea but for me coffee and cake in the same package is perfect!
You bake the cupcakes in their liners and place them in the cup. Otherwise you will have guests trying to scoop the cupcake out of the cup - very messy..

I've baked cake in small canning jars. When I bake them I put the jars in a 10x13 pan with about and inch of water in the bottom. Never had a problem with breaking. I have instructions and pictures on my blog if you want to take a look.
